Runbook: Ferngate address autocomplete widget. If suggestions stop appearing, first check the widget health endpoint; a 503 usually means the geocode cache is cold after a deploy. Warm it by replaying the seed file from the ops bucket. If the cache is warm but lookups still fail, the backend is rejecting unauthenticated requests, which happens when the env file was regenerated without credentials. Restore it by appending the following line to the service env file.

secret setting of yajog-taguf: ARCHIVE_KEY3=051

## Account Recovery — Hermetic Build Cutover

Scope: release manager only. During the Skellbright migration to the Cask hermetic build system, legacy CI credentials are frozen. If the builder account locks mid-cutover, do not recreate it; recover it. Steps: halt queued builds, snapshot the toolchain cache, switch the manifest to pinned inputs, then reattach the account. Verify one hermetic build passes before resuming. To unlock the builder account, enter the recovery passphrase below.

recovery phrase for fajep-yaweg: gilath-sorox-wenius-rusdor-keliel-zorius

## Incremental Rebuilds

The Marrowleaf site uses incremental static rebuilds: only pages whose content hashes changed since the last deploy are regenerated, which keeps typical builds under thirty seconds. The rebuild graph lives in `.marrow/graph.json`; never edit it by hand, as a corrupted graph forces a full rebuild. Deploys are pushed from CI to the edge host over an authenticated channel. That channel authenticates with the deploy key shown here:

rollout seal: bky4_x7Gc